Lincat Group is seeking an IT Technician for a 12-month contract, based in Lincoln. The successful candidate will support the IT Manager in managing day-to-day IT activities, including the rollout of Windows 11 and providing first-line IT support.
Strong experience in IT support and knowledge of networking and systems administration are essential. This is an excellent opportunity to work in a dynamic environment with a leading manufacturer of catering equipment.
